East Providence Vs Rhode Island And National Crime Rates

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in East Providence is 754.9 per 100,000 people. That's -64.38% lower than the national rate of 2,119.2 per 100,000 people and -36.34% lower than the Rhode Island total crime rate of 1,185.9 per 100,000 people.

Violent Crime Rates In East Providence

35Violent Crimes
73.6Violent Crimes / 100k People
-79.50%Below The National Average
East Providence
US
  • There were 35 violent crimes in East Providence in the last reporting year.
  • The violent crime rate in East Providence is 73.6 per 100,000 people.
  • You have a 1 in 1,358.7 chance of being the victim of a violent crime in East Providence each year. That compares to a 1 in 651.2 chance statewide.
  • That's -79.50% lower than the national rate of 359.0 per 100,000 people.
  • And -52.07% lower than the Rhode Island violent crime rate of 153.6 per 100,000 people.
